>Does anybody know how I must configure Linux so that it it can use >my
>Teles 16.3 non-PnP ISA ISDN
>adaptor? I want use the adaptor to retrieve e-mail and to use it with
>the internet.
No very dificult :
Compile the kernel for ISDN.
Include PPP support, and MPPP (Channel bundling)
Select the Siemens chipset, and then you can choose the 16.3 card.
Then get the isdn4k-utils rpm somewhere. I could't managet to get the
original package to compile.
Then just read the doc's, and have a look at the examples.
>And than comes the following question: How can I let Linux call out to
>the internet using the ISDN adapter.
It thinks the ISDN adapter is a Network Interface Card (NIC). When packets
come in, ipppd dials in.
